kibbeh nayyeh (raw kibbeh)
Traditionally served with the Lebanese mezze (appetizer course), this dish can be served raw or cooked and traditionally uses lamb. Here is a tasty raw version of this dish...
*1c brazil nuts
*1c peanuts
*pinch of salt
*1tsp pepper, and 1tsp to garnish
*1tsp cinnamon
*1/4tsp
cumin
*1 onion, finely chopped
*2T olive oil
*1tsp mint
*1 mint sprig (garnish)
combine nuts in the food processor; process until the mix forms a light fluff. add in the salt, 1tsp pepper, cinnamon, onion, olive oil, and mint. pulse until uniformly mixed, and a moldable dough forms. form kibbeh into football-shaped balls, and dehydrate for up to 8 hrs, or until the kibbeh do not crumble apart and can hold their shape well.
